Understanding the Speed Capabilities


Most commercially available self-balancing scooters can reach speeds between 6 to 12 miles per hour (mph) depending on their design, battery capacity, and the weight limit they can support. Entry-level models often have a top speed of around 6-8 mph, making them suitable for beginner riders or younger users. On the other hand, premium models with advanced features and higher performance capabilities can reach speeds closer to 12 mph, providing a thrilling experience for more experienced ride enthusiasts.


A scooter's speed is influenced by a variety of factors, including the power of its motors, the capacity of its battery, and the terrain on which it is used. Most high-quality scooters come equipped with dual motors, which allow for better traction, enabling the scooter to climb small hills and navigate uneven surfaces effectively while maintaining its speed.


The Technology Behind the Speed


At the heart of every self-balancing scooter is a sophisticated system of sensors and motors that work together to maintain balance and control. These scooters utilize gyroscopic sensors to detect the rider's movements; leaning forward accelerates the scooter, while leaning back slows it down or stops it. The responsiveness of these sensors plays a crucial role in how a scooter handles at higher speeds. Scooters designed for speed incorporate advanced algorithms that enhance stability, allowing riders to maneuver safely even when traveling at higher velocities.

Moreover, the quality of the battery significantly impacts how fast a self-balancing scooter can go. A high-capacity lithium-ion battery not only provides sufficient power for quicker acceleration but also ensures longer ride times at high speeds without compromising performance. Riders should always check the specifications of the battery before making a purchase to ensure they select a model that meets their needs.


Safety Considerations


While the thrill of speed can enhance the riding experience, it is essential to recognize the safety aspects associated with high-speed travel on self-balancing scooters. At speeds above 10 mph, challenges such as stopping distance and loss of balance become critical considerations. Riders are more susceptible to accidents if they do not have adequate experience or if they venture onto surfaces that do not provide adequate traction.


To enhance safety, many manufacturers recommend that riders wear protective gear, such as helmets, knee pads, and elbow pads, especially when riding at higher speeds. Additionally, potential buyers should evaluate the scooter's safety features, such as LED lights for visibility, anti-slip foot pads, and robust braking systems, as these can significantly minimize the risk of accidents.
